Chapter 6: Connect to External AV Device

6.1 Connect Video Cable

Freecom MediaPlayer supports 4 types of video output; "Composite, S-video, Component,

DVI". Use the video connection that your TV supports. Normally, TV supports composite

video connection, and this package includes composite video cable.

When you can not see normal screen after connecting video cable, check

following:

1. "TV "– Switch to Video Input Mode: Turn on TV, and switch to video input mode same

as video connection. See TV user manual.

2. "Freecom MediaPlayer" – Switch to Video Output Mode: Press "TV OUT" button

repeatedly. Whenever "TV OUT" is pressed, the video output signal changes.

3. When a normal screen appears, save the configurations of the Freecom MediaPlayer.

See "6.3.1 Video Setup".

1. Composite: Yellow RCA cable. (Supplied)

2. S-Video: Black rounded cable (not supplied)

4, DVI : DVI Cable (not supplied)

3. Component: Y, Pb, Pr component cable (not supplied)
